The WVU College of Commerce was born by order of the state higher education board on Nov. 10, 1951 and has been known as the College of Business and Economics since 1971. The College offers six bachelor's, six master's, and three doctoral degrees. The College has an undergraduate enrollment of approximately 2,000, a graduate enrollment of over 300, and more than 20,000 alumni worldwide. Business programs at the WVU College of Business & Economics are accredited by AACSB International - The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business.
